Sizing question

DS wears 12-18 month clothes - he is just getting into strictly 18 month size.  There is a Just Between Friends sale this weekend for winter clothes.  I live in MN, where it stays cold until March usually...sometimes May.  He is set for 18 month, but do you think I should get him winter stuff in 24 month size?  It is so hard to know!  His growing is definitely slowing down.

  • Chicago here, and my LO is in the 97th percentile for height, so I feel ya! I have 18 month clothes, but bought cardigans and her heavy winter coat in 24/2T. I plan to layer cardigans over her clothes if the sleeves get short and I really wanted the coat to last through spring since it is god awful cold up until then. Don't buy a lot of things bigger than that. If you do, buy spring or summer things and then layer them up!

  • I would do a bigger size in shirts and jackets that you can roll the sleeves up.
  • Maybe a couple pairs of pants in the bigger size? When I wear ds in the carrier or have him in the stroller, the pant legs ride up and leave his lower legs exposed, so I prefer pants that are a little big, and then I can cuff them or uncuff them if he needs extra length.

  • I would buy both sizes.  You never know!
  • DD is the same way. I bought all her winter clothes in 24 month because I knew there was no way 18 months would fit until May when it is warm enough to start wearing short sleeves. I just cuff her pants and shirt sleeves and she is set to go!
